Millimeter wave spectroscopy of rocks and fluids

One region of the electromagnetic spectrum that is relatively unexploited for materials characterization is the millimeter wave band frequencies roughly between 40 and 300 GHz . Accelerated plane-wave destruction

When plane-wave destruction (PWD) is implemented by implicit finite differences, the local slope is estimated by an iterative algorithm. We propose an analytical estimator of the local slope that is based on convergence analysis of the iterative algorithm. Lecture 5 Classical and Molecular Approaches to Plant Improvement

The genetic aspect of plant improvement involves the identification and generation of superior genotypes. Molecular approaches for detection and identification of foodborne pathogens

Foodborne pathogens comprise microorganisms such as viruses, bacteria and parasites that can be transmitted by food and affect public health worldwide. The most common viruses transmitted via food are hepatitis A virus and Norwalk-like caliciviruses.
